Can someone list each version? I'm struggling to wrap my head around how many different versions one can put out. Is there anything stopping her from releasing more?
Here's a recap!
CDs:
1. Collectors Edition Deluxe The Manuscript CD
2. Collectors Edition Deluxe Albatross CD
3. Collectors Edition Deluxe The Bolter CD
4. Collectors Edition Deluxe The Black Dog CD
5. Standard Album + The Manuscript
6. Standard Album + The Manuscript (Signed)
7. Standard Album + But Daddy I Love Him (Acoustic)
8. Standard Album + Guilty As Sin? (Acoustic)
9. Standard Album + Down Bad (Acoustic)
10. Standard Album + Fortnight (Acoustic)
11. Standard Album + Fresh Out The Slammer (Acoustic)
12. Target Ed Albatross CD
13. Target Ed The Bolter CD
14. Target Ed The Black Dog CD
VINYLS:
15. Target Ed Vinyl
16. The Manuscript Vinyl (Pressing 1) - The Tortured Poets Department 2×LP, Album, Clear \[Phantom Clear\],Vantiva Pressing
17. The Manuscript Vinyl (Pressing 2) - The Tortured Poets Department 2×LP, Album, Clear \[Phantom Clear\] Optimal Media GmbH Pressing
18. The Albatross Vinyl
19. The Bolter Vinyl
20. The Black Dog Vinyl
21. The Manuscript Vinyl (signed)
DIGITAL:
22. The Anthology
23. Standard Album + Black Dog voice memo
24. Standard Album + Who's Afraid of Little Old Me voice memo
25. Standard Album + Cassandra voice memo
26. Standard Album
27. Standard Album + Daddy I Love Him (acoustic)
28. Standard Album + loml live from Paris
29. Standard Album + MBOBHFT live from Paris
30. Standard Album + The Alchemy/Treacherous mashup live from Paris
CASSETTES:
31. File Name: The Manuscript" with bonus track "The Manuscript
32. File Name: The Bolter" with bonus track "The Bolter
33. File Name: The Albatross" with bonus track "The Albatross
34. File Name: The Black Dog" with bonus track "The Black Dog
